On Reading Dushyanta Kumar's Gandhiji Ke Janmadin Par Poem by Bijay Kant Dubey

On Reading Dushyanta Kumar's Gandhiji Ke Janmadin Par



I shall take my birth again,
Again I
Shall come here

I shall try to hear the pains
Gone unheard so far,
The pains and sorrows of the people

I shall try to dress the wounds,
Bandage and balm
So the pain gets mitigated

Whatever say you, I shall keep
Doing and doing it,
Whatever think you about

I shall come, shall come again,
Again to speak the truth,
The undaunted truth.
